1Variation of head and facial morphological characteristics with increased age of Han in Southern China显示文摘We investigated 13940 (6735 male, 7250 female) adult head and facial physical attributes from 19 different Han ethnic groups in 10 southern-China provinces, and calculated 12 head and facial indexes. Indexes were used to analyze the variation of head and facial morphological characteristics with increased age. Results showed that as age increases: (1) Head breadth, minimum frontal breadth, face breadth, interocular breadth, external biocular breadth, lip height, lip thickness, head circumference, auricular height, length-breadth head index, length-height head index, and lip-index values decline significantly in a linear fashion. (2) Nose breadth, mouth breadth, morphological facial height, upper-lip height, physiognomic ear length, physiognomic ear breadth, visor skin-fold, and vertical head-facial index values significantly increase in a linear fashion.LI YongLan ZHENG LianBin YU KeLi LU ShunHua ZHANG XingHua LI YuLing WANG Yang XUE Hong DENG Wei 2013Chinese Science Bulletin2013,58,4:20

5CALTPP:A general program to calculate thermophysical properties显示文摘A program CALTPP(CALculation of ThermoPhysical Properties)is developed in order to provide various thermophysical properties such as diffusion coefficient,interfacial energy,thermal conductivity,viscosity and molar volume mainly as function of temperature and composition.These thermophysical properties are very important inputs for microstructure simulations and mechanical property predictions.The general structure of CALTPP is briefly described,and the CALPHAD-type models for the description of these thermophysical properties are presented.The CALTPP program contains the input module,calculation and/or optimization modules and output module.A few case studies including(a)the calculation of diffusion coefficient and optimization of atomic mobility,(b)the calculation of solid/liquid,coherent solid/solid and liquid/liquid interfacial energies,(c)the calculation of thermal conductivity,(d)the calculation of viscosity,and(e)the establishment of molar volume database in binary and ternary alloys are demonstrated to show the features of CALTPP.It is expected that CALTPP will be an effective contribution in both scientific research and education.Yuling Liu Cong Zhang Changfa Du Yong Du Zhoushun Zheng Shuhong Liu Lei Huang Shiyi Wen Youliang Jin Huaqing Zhang Fan Zhang George Kaptay 2020Journal of Materials Science & Technology2020,42,7:2
6Effect of blocking Ras signaling pathway with K-Ras siRNA on apoptosis in esophageal squamous carcinoma cells显示文摘OBJECTIVE: To study the effect of RNAi silencing of the K-Ras gene on Ras signal pathway activity in EC9706 esophageal cancer cells. METHODS: EC9706 cells were treated in the following six groups: blank group (no transfection), negative control group (transfection no-carrier), transfection group (transfected with pSilencer-siK-ras), taxol chemotherapy group, taxol chemotherapy plus no-carrier group, taxol chemotherapy plus transfection group. Immunocytochemistry, Reverse transcription-polymerase chain reaction and western blotting were used to analyze the expression of MAPK1 (mitogen-activated protein kinases 1) and cyclin D1 in response to siRNA (small interfering RNA) transfection and taxol treatment. RESULTS: K-Ras (K-Ras gene) siRNA transfection of EC9706 esophageal squamous carcinoma cells decreased the expression of K-Ras, MAPK1 and cyclinD1 at the mRNA and protein level. Reverse transcription-polymerase chain reaction indicated that the expression levels of MAPK1 and cyclin D1 mRNAs were significantly lower in the transfection group than in the blank group (P<0.05). Western blotting showed that 72 h after EC9706 cell transfection, the expression levels of MAPK1 and cyclin D1 proteins had decreased in all groups, and the expression levels in the transfection group were significantly inhibited as compared with the blank group. Apoptosis increased significantly in the transfection group or after addition of taxol as compared with the blank group and the no-carrier group. The degree of apoptosis in the taxol plus transfection group was more severe. CONCLUSION: Apoptosis increased significantly in EC9706 esophageal carcinoma cells after siRNA-mediated inhibition of Ras signaling, with the most obvious increase observed in the transfection plus taxol chemotherapy group. Ras knockdown therefore increased cellular sensitivity to the chemotherapeutic agent, taxol. Ras knockdown also down-regulated the expression of the downstream genes, MAPK1 and cyclin D1, thus inhibiting the growth, proliferation and metabolism of esophageal cancer cells.Xinjie Wang Yuling Zheng Qingxia Fan Xudong Zhang 2013Journal of Traditional Chinese Medicine2013,33,3:2

12Evaluation of Farmland Drainage Water Quality by Fuzzy–Gray Combination Method显示文摘The complex relationships between indicators and water conditions cause fuzzy and gray uncertainties in evaluation of water quality. Compared to conventional single-factor evaluation methods, the combination evaluation method can consider these two uncertainties to produce more objective and reasonable evaluation results. In this paper, we propose a combination evaluation method with two main parts:(1) the use of fuzzy comprehensive evaluation and gray correlation analysis as submodels with which to consider the fuzzy and gray uncertainties and(2) the establishment of a combination model based on minimum bias squares. In addition, using this method, we evaluate the water quality of a ditch in a typical rice–wheat system of Yixing city in the Taihu Lake Basin during three rainfall events. The results show that the ditch water quality is not good and we found the chemical oxygen demand to be the key indicator that affects water quality most significantly. The proposed combination evaluation method is more accurate and practical than single-factor evaluation methods in that it considers the uncertainties of fuzziness and grayness.Xiaoling Wang Songmin Li Yuling Yan Xiaotong Zheng Fuchao Zhang 2019Transactions of Tianjin University2019,25,1:1
13Body weights in Han Chinese populations显示文摘The body weights of 26,954 Han Chinese adults in 67 areas(16,503 in rural areas and 10,451 in urban areas) across China were measured from 2009 to2013.The results showed that in China,the three areas(north China,northeast China,and Jianghuai Plain) were with the greatest body weight.Northwest Han Chinese populations were heavier.Southwestern dialect groups were at the middle level and lighter than northern Han Chinese populations,but were heavier among southern Han Chinese populations.Chinese Han who located in areas of Hangjiahu were the general level,and similar to southwestern dialect groups.The mean values of body weight in Hunan Han and Fujian Han were greater than other Han groups in southern China.Gan dialect groups and Cantonese dialect groups showed the minimum body weightvalue in all Chinese Han groups.Besides,the mean body weight of Hakka was heavier than Gan dialect groups and Cantonese dialect groups which were adjacent to Hakka.Body weight increases with an increase in height,bone diameter,subcutaneous fat on the limbs and trunk,chest circumference,and abdomen circumference.This study revealed that northern Han men were heavier than southern Han men,because the former were taller and had a larger waist circumference as well as thicker subcutaneous fat on their backs.Among women,height,bone diameter of the upper limbs,chest and abdomen circumferences,and subcutaneous fat on the limbs and trunks of northern Han exceeded those of rural southern Han.Consequently,body weight values of northern Han women were higher than those of southern Han women.While a significant difference in these values was found between urban and rural men,no significant difference occurred between urban and rural women.Body weight was associated with age in urban and rural men only in the case of minority groups.However,there was a positive correlation between body weight and age in the majority groups of both urban and rural women.The particular composition of genes involved in body weight traits of Han populations across the country has created a genetic foundation accounting for varying body weights of different Han populations.Environmental factors also play a role.As the Han are widely dispersed,their habitation areas vary according to factors such as topography,temperature,precipitation,humidity,and light.Moreover,labor intensity,food composition,and the intake of various nutrients also differ across Han populations.All of these factors have affected the development of body weight in Han populations living in different locations.Yonglan Li Lianbin Zheng Huanjiu Xi Keli Yu Shunhua Lu Jinyuan Tian Xue Song Jinping Bao Yuling Li Xinghua Zhang Youfeng Wen Fu Ren 2014Chinese Science Bulletin2014,59,35:1

20Identification of binding domains and key amino acids involved in the interaction between BmLARK and G4 structure in the BmPOUM2 promoter in Bombyx mori显示文摘It has been found that the non-B form DNA structures,like G-quadruplex(G4)and i-motif,are involved in many important biological processes.Our previous study showed that the silkworm transcription factor BmLARK binds to the G4 structure in the promoter of the transcription factor BmPOUM2 and regulates its promoter activity.However,the binding mechanism between BmLARK and BmPOUM2 G4 structure remains unclear.In this study,binding domains and key amino acid residues involved in the interaction between BmLARK and BmPOUM2 G4 were studied.The electrophoretic mobility shift assay results indicated that the two RNA-recognition motifs(RRM)of BmLARK are simultaneously required for the binding with the G4 structure.Either RRM1 or RRM2 alone could not bind with the G4 structure.The zinc-finger motif was not involved in the binding.A series of mutant proteins with specific amino acid mutations were expressed and used to identify the key amino acid residues involving the interaction.The results indicated thatβsheets,especially theβ1 andβ3 sheets,in the RRM domains of BmLARK played critical roles in the binding with the G4 structure.Several amino acid mutations of RRM1/2 in ribonucleoprotein domain 1(RNP1)(motif inβ3 strand)and RNP2(motif inβ1 strand)caused loss of binding ability,indicating that these amino acids are the key sites for the binding.All the results suggest that RRM domains,particularly their the RNP1 and RNP2 motifs,play important roles not only in RNA recognition,but also in the G4 structure binding.Yuling Peng Kangkang Niu Guoxing Yu Mingxi Zheng Qiulan Wei Qisheng Song Qili Feng 2021Insect Science2021,28,4:0
